Traffic update: Delays on M6 due to collapsed manhole

UPDATE: EMERGENCY carriageway repair work is causing severe delays on the M6 in Cheshire.

The southbound carriageway has one lane closed between J17 (Congleton) and J16 (Crewe) for emergency repairs to a collapsed manhole.

Two lanes remain open to traffic.

The Highways agency has advised that road users may wish to consider alternative routes.

Meanwhile, to update a morning traffic alert, the northbound carriageway of the M6 remains affected between junctions 31 for Preston and Junction 32 for Blackpool following a HGV fire last night.

Two lanes have now been opened to traffic.

The HGV was transporting a load of aerosols and car wax which have spilled across the carriageway causing damage to the road.

The Highways Agency has advised that road users may wish to consider exiting the M6 at J31 and take the A59 westbound towards Preston. Then take the A6 northbound. At J1 for the M55, take the eastbound exit to rejoin the M6 at J32.
